Multiple targets imaging using inverse synthetic aperture technique is a key problem on radar imaging field. This paper proposes a new approach to perform the motion compensation for multiple targets using randomized Hough transform (RHT). The targets' amplitude distribution, i.e., corrugation image is transformed into frequency domain, then The RHT processing is operated on the frequency image to estimate each target's Doppler frequencies respectively, and the multi-target ISAR images will be obtained after range alignment and phase compensation processing for each object respectively.
